Trabaja mientras estudias

Spain welcomes international students to gain practical experience while pursuing their studies. Students holding a student visa are allowed to work part-time during the academic year and full-time during official vacation periods. This flexibility provides students with the opportunity to immerse themselves in the Spanish work culture, enhance language proficiency, and gain valuable insights into their chosen field. Many universities in Spain also facilitate internships, enabling students to apply theoretical knowledge in real-world scenarios. Working while studying in Spain not only contributes to financial independence but also adds a meaningful dimension to the overall educational experience.

Oportunidades após os estudos

Spain, known for its vibrant culture and welcoming atmosphere, offers international students enticing post-study opportunities. Graduates can apply for the Non-Lucrative Visa, granting them the right to stay in Spain for up to one year while actively searching for employment. With a secured job offer, they can transition to a work visa, opening up avenues for potential long-term residency. This holistic approach reflects Spain’s commitment to attracting skilled individuals who can contribute to its dynamic workforce and cultural tapestry.

Migración oportunidades

Spain, with its warm culture, welcomes skilled technology professionals with open arms. Key migration opportunities include:

Highly Qualified Professionals Visa: Spain’s visa for highly qualified professionals offers a pathway for skilled technology workers to contribute to the country’s workforce.

Entrepreneur Visa: Tech entrepreneurs can explore the Entrepreneur Visa, allowing them to establish businesses in Spain with potential routes to permanent residency.

Golden Visa: Investors in technology can consider the Golden Visa program, providing residency for those making significant investments.

Spain invites skilled technology professionals, offering tailored opportunities for a fulfilling career and lifestyle.
